End-to-End Testing for Mobile: Beginners Guide

FinalrunFinalrun
4 min read

End-to-end (E2E) testing is a software testing methodology that involves testing an application's workflow from beginning to end. It simulates real user scenarios to validate the system and its components for integration and data integrity. This guide will delve into the specifics of E2E testing for mobile applications, exploring a user flow from login to checkout, multi-app testing, and data validation using APIs and databases. We'll also touch upon the role of CI/CD in accelerating the testing and development lifecycle.

A User Flow in the App: From Login to Checkout

Imagine a retail mobile application. A typical user journey, or user flow, could be:

  1. Login: The user launches the app and logs in with their credentials. The E2E test would verify that the app successfully authenticates the user and grants access to their account.

  2. Search and Select: The user searches for a product, applies filters, and selects an item. The test would ensure that the search and filter functionalities work correctly and that the product details are displayed accurately.

  3. Add to Cart: The user adds the selected item to their shopping cart. Here, the test validates that the cart is updated with the correct product and quantity.

  4. Checkout: The user proceeds to checkout, enters their shipping and payment information, and confirms the order. The test would verify that the order is placed successfully and that the user receives a confirmation.

Throughout this flow, the E2E test simulates user interactions like tapping buttons, entering text, and swiping through screens to ensure a seamless experience.

Multiple App Testing in the Same Flow

In many modern service ecosystems, a single user transaction can span across multiple applications. For instance, consider a food delivery service which might involve a consumer app, a Point of Sale (POS) app at the restaurant, and a delivery app.

An E2E test for such a scenario would look like this:

  1. A user places an order on the consumer app.

  2. The E2E test would then need to verify that the order is received and displayed correctly on the restaurant's POS app.

  3. Once the restaurant accepts the order, the test would check if a notification is sent to the delivery app, assigning a driver for the delivery.

  4. The test can further track the order status on the consumer app as it changes from "Order Placed" to "In Transit" and finally "Delivered".

This type of testing is crucial to ensure that the entire ecosystem of apps works in harmony to deliver a smooth customer experience.

App with API or Database to Validate Data

To ensure data integrity across systems, E2E tests can be augmented with API and database validations. After a user completes a checkout on the consumer app, an automated test can make an API call to the backend server to verify that the order details (e.g., product ID, quantity, price, shipping address) are correctly stored in the database.

This approach combines the "black-box" testing of the UI with "white-box" testing of the backend, providing a more comprehensive validation of the system. It helps in identifying issues that might not be visible on the user interface, such as incorrect data storage or processing errors.

CI/CD for Faster Iteration

Continuous Integration and Continuous Deployment (CI/CD) is a practice that automates the software development and release process. Integrating E2E tests into the CI/CD pipeline offers significant advantages:

  • Early Bug Detection: E2E tests can be configured to run automatically every time new code is committed. This helps in catching bugs early in the development cycle, reducing the cost and effort required for fixing them.

  • Faster Feedback Loop: Developers get quick feedback on their changes, allowing them to iterate faster and improve the quality of the code.

  • Increased Confidence in Releases: With a robust suite of automated E2E tests, the development team can have higher confidence in the stability and quality of the application, leading to smoother and more frequent releases.

By automating the entire process from code commit to testing and deployment, CI/CD empowers teams to deliver high-quality mobile applications at a faster pace.

In conclusion, a well-defined E2E testing strategy is indispensable for developing high-quality mobile applications. By simulating real user scenarios, testing across multiple apps, validating data through APIs and databases, and integrating tests into a CI/CD pipeline, development teams can ensure a seamless user experience, maintain data integrity, and accelerate their release cycles.
